Psychoeducation Testing
This is a comprehensive evaluation available for young children to adults. The test is performed by a trained professional that works with clients and their parents or caretakers to identify strengths and weaknesses in a wide range of areas, including cognition, academics, general development, socio-emotional skills, etc.
The goal of testing is to inform and enhance the ability of everyone involved to improve success for the client. We test for the following: Autism, ADHD, Reading Disorders, Learning Disorders, Dyslexia, Dysgraphia, Dyscalculia, Math Disorder, Written Language Disorder, Nonverbal Learning Disorder (NVLD), Personality, Bipolar Disorder, Oppositional Defiant Disorder, Obsessive Compulsive Disorder, Mood, Anxiety and more!
